The red wine Altino Rioja DOCa, vintage 2008 from the winery Bodegas Obalo has been rated in 2011 by Peter Moser with 88 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the region La Rioja in Spain.

Tasting Notes

88
Tasting from 30.06.2011: Peter Moser

The first wine from this new luxury winery. 100% Tempranillo from 30 selected parcels; average vine age: 50 years. Dark ruby with violet. Very smoky, raisined, ripe dark blackberry, cassis and cherry aromas, deep and also with freshness. Concentrated and powerful on the palate, juicy fullness with subtle sweetness and a tart cocoa note, mineral undertones. Firm, even austere tannins. Restrained length.
